What To Expect

Join us for a transformative weekend full of adventure, fellowship, and growth! We will share 5 meals together, starting with dinner Friday night, and concluding with breakfast on Sunday. We can accommodate most dietary restrictions and try our best to offer quality substitutes. We offer two lodging options: Mountain View Cabins or Cedar Lodge rooms.

We will engage in four worship sessions together, learning from our speaker and one another in reflection times. You can choose between many activities during Saturday free time, whether it’s zipling, hatchet throwing, or our annual Irish Road Bowling competition!

This weekend will provide opportunity for quality time with other men, as well as solo reflection time. Our hope is that you can choose what is most replenishing to you!

Retreat Speaker

Ian Hodge

Ian grew up in the Seattle area, which explains his otherwise puzzling love of all things Seattle sports. He graduated from Biola University, where he met his future wife Mikaela, with whom he has 4 children, including the only daughter in three generations of Hodges. After several years as a banker in Downtown Seattle, Ian and Mikaela responded to God’s call to the pastorate by enrolling at Talbot School of Theology where Ian obtained his M.Div. Ian served as the pastor of Lemon Cove Community Church in central California for 10 years before receiving the call to serve as the pastor of FPC Carson City. Ian’s favorite book is The Great Divorce by C.S. Lewis, his hobbies include cooking, hiking, and, when he is well rested, backyard astronomy. After the Holy Spirit, the animating principle of Ian’s faith and ministry is Colossians 2:13-15; Jesus Christ, the one and only Son of God, has defeated sin and death in an absolute shellacking to make us alive!

Pricing

Rates are per person and include two nights lodging, five meals, speaker and worship sessions, and all recreational activities. A $75 non-refundable deposit is required with registration per camper. All non-refundable deposits are applied toward the total tuition due. Final payment is due Friday, October 23, 2026. Refunds are not guaranteed for cancellations made within two weeks of event start date. Campership applications are available upon request.

$275 - $325

Per Person

Limited Space Available! Register by October 23rd!

Cedar Lodge:

Multiple Occupancy: $325 each

Mountain View Cabins: 

Multiple Occupancy: $275 each

Single occupancy is not guaranteed but may be requested. 

An additional $50 fee applies for single occupancy.
